Output 50605598047207e6c3eb6b2e765432a0e893952e928bc534a7998d951602577b:0

value
85784804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54db23d83b0730108f180fbe31cc2739b3994686 OP_EQUAL
address
MFdqWfCGG9u3CuuE5eFWs2dtbzuAzuYn1A
transaction
50605598047207e6c3eb6b2e765432a0e893952e928bc534a7998d951602577b
spent
true